Job description

Licensed Mental Health Therapist — Nationwide Interest Pool
Remote · Open to All U.S. States


We have plans of expanding nationwide. If we're not in your state yet, we want to know you.

Backpack Healthcare provides mental health care for children, teens, and young adults — all online, covered by most insurance. We're clinician-led and minority-owned, and we're growing fast. We currently operate in Illinois, Maryland, Virginia, Arizona, and Georgia — and we're actively building toward a nationwide footprint.

If you're a licensed therapist who believes in accessible, culturally responsive care for kids and families, we want to hear from you now — before we get to your state.


How this works

This isn't a traditional job posting. It's an invitation to get on our radar early. Once you apply, you'll be added to our expansion talent pool. When we launch in your state, you'll be among the first people we reach out to — no starting from scratch, no waiting on a job board.


What working at Backpack looks like

Our therapists provide individual, family, and group therapy via telehealth — fully remote, flexible scheduling, with a real interdisciplinary team behind them. When we expand into your state, here's what you can expect:

  • Flexible part-time or full-time caseloads
  • Competitive per-billable-hour compensation based on license level
  • Free clinical supervision for eligible licenses
  • CEU reimbursement and ongoing training
  • 401(k) with company match
  • A collaborative team of therapists, PMHNPs, and psychiatrists working together
  • Pathways into clinical leadership as we grow

What we're looking for

  • Active U.S. state license: LPC, LCPC, LCSW, LMFT, or equivalent independently licensed credential
  • Experience with or strong interest in working with children, teens, and families
  • Comfortable working independently in a remote telehealth environment
  • Committed to trauma-informed, culturally responsive practice
  • Bilingual — strongly preferred across all markets

Who we are

We've served 12,000+ kids and families since 2020. 78% of families report their child is doing better after three months of care. We started because finding quality, affordable mental health care for kids was too hard — and we're building something to change that, one state at a time.
